The ecdsa module already defaults to using urandom.
This commit is contained in:
parent
6f211115f4
commit
6c6969c188
|
@ -102,8 +102,7 @@ class ECDSAKey (PKey):
|
||||||
|
|
||||||
def sign_ssh_data(self, data):
|
def sign_ssh_data(self, data):
|
||||||
digest = SHA256.new(data).digest()
|
digest = SHA256.new(data).digest()
|
||||||
sig = self.signing_key.sign_digest(digest, entropy=os.urandom,
|
sig = self.signing_key.sign_digest(digest, sigencode=self._sigencode)
|
||||||
sigencode=self._sigencode)
|
|
||||||
m = Message()
|
m = Message()
|
||||||
m.add_string('ecdsa-sha2-nistp256')
|
m.add_string('ecdsa-sha2-nistp256')
|
||||||
m.add_string(sig)
|
m.add_string(sig)
|
||||||
|
|
Loading…
Reference in New Issue